Republican gubernatorial candidate Steve Hilton on Thursday released his five-point plan to revive California‘s sagging film and television industry, noting, “The lights are literally going out in Hollywood.”
A former Fox News host who announced his governor bid a year ago, Hilton is the GOP front-runner in the race, according to several polls this week. He appeared at the site of the shuttered Cinerama Dome in Hollywood on Thursday to tout his ideas on how to boost movie and TV production in the Golden State.
